Western Lake Home
Hayden Lake
This North Idaho lake residence was designed to maximize its generous views of the lake and mountains while meeting the needs of a large family. The lodge is accented to exude a warm, comfortable living environment fit for a growing family through its timber trusses and columns; cedar siding and high ceilings; cherry wood cabinets, door, and trim; stone counter tops; tile floors; richly colored plaster walls; and granite fireplaces. The residence features seven sleeping areas, being a large master suite, four children’s bedrooms, a bunkroom for sleepovers, and a one bedroom guest house attached by a bridge and stair tower. The connecting bridge between the guest house and main house features a natural drainage area underneath, which was enhanced to act as a water feature in the summer with a series of connecting pools, while serving as a runoff stream during the spring snow melt. A hydronic heating system maintains even temperatures throughout the home and keeps the paver driveway clear of snow and ice in the winter. Along with the heating system, state of the art sound, lighting, and home automation systems were installed to provide complete control over the house.
